Abstract

The utility model belongs to the field of electronic product and discloses a multi-screen display. The side edge of the main screen of the display is connected with a sub-display. The side edge of the main display is connected with one or more sub-displays. The sub-display can rotate along a connecting axis or make rotation movement along the direction of a rotating shaft vertical to the connecting axis at the same time. The multi-screen display can ensure the user to use a plurality of screens at the same time or ensure a plurality of people to watch the content in the computer, thus enlarging the serviceable range of the display.

Embodiment
Embodiment one:
See also Fig. 1, a kind of multihead display device, main display 1 links to each other with pedestal 5, and main display 1 right edge is connected with secondary display screen 2 by connecting axle 3, makes main display 1 and secondary display screen 2 form folding framework, can rotate mutually along connecting axle 3.Secondary display screen 2 can go to other directions, and the handled easily person uses.
The secondary display screen 2 of the utility model can be along connecting axle 3 towards different directions, and operator and presentation objects are used two display screens respectively during as demonstration.Two display screens can be simultaneously towards the operator during as double screen.
The utility model can go to secondary display screen 2 main display 1 behind, can use main screen separately and hide secondary display screen.
Embodiment two:
See also Fig. 2, a kind of multihead display device, main display 1 links to each other with pedestal 5, and main display 1 upper side edge is connected with secondary display screen 2 by connecting axle 3, makes main display 1 and secondary display screen 2 form folding framework, can rotate mutually along connecting axle 3.Secondary display screen 2 can go to other directions, and the handled easily person uses.
The utility model can go to secondary display screen 2 main display 1 behind, can be used as many people's demonstrations or hiding secondary display screen and uses main display separately.
Present embodiment is compared with embodiment one, and the connecting axle of secondary display screen and main display has reduced the lateral stress of computer at the main screen upper side edge, and computer is put more steady, floor space and weight that can corresponding minimizing pedestal.
Embodiment three:
See also Fig. 3,4, a kind of multihead display device, main display 1 links to each other with pedestal 5, on main display 1 right edge connecting axle 3 is arranged, rotating shaft 4 perpendicular to connecting axle 3 is arranged on the connecting axle 3, main display 1 is connected with secondary display screen 2 with rotating shaft 4 by the connecting axle on the side 3, makes secondary display screen 2 not only can make axial rotation but also can rotate along the rotating shaft 4 perpendicular to connecting axle 3 along connecting axle 3.
Compare with embodiment one, the secondary display screen 2 of the utility model is towards more direction, and operator and presentation objects are used two display screens respectively during as demonstration.Two display screens can be simultaneously towards the operator during as double screen.
The utility model can go to secondary display screen 2 main display 1 behind, and towards main display 1, but the secondary display screen 2 of better protection.
